The construction of a dam wall is one of the most significant engineering feats in modern civilization. A dam wall is a barrier built across a river or stream to hold back water, creating a reservoir for various purposes, such as hydroelectric power generation, irrigation, flood control, and recreation. The importance of a dam wall cannot be overstated, as it plays a crucial role in managing water resources and ensuring the safety of communities living downstream.In many regions, especially those prone to drought or flooding, a well-constructed dam wall can provide a reliable source of water for agricultural and domestic use. By capturing rainwater and runoff, these structures help to stabilize water supply throughout the year, allowing farmers to cultivate crops even during dry seasons. Moreover, the reservoir created by a dam wall can serve as a crucial water source for drinking and sanitation, improving the quality of life for nearby populations.Additionally, a dam wall is vital for generating hydroelectric power. As water flows over the dam wall, it turns turbines that produce electricity. This renewable energy source is essential for reducing dependence on fossil fuels and mitigating climate change. Countries around the world are increasingly investing in hydroelectric projects, recognizing that a strong and efficient dam wall is integral to harnessing this clean energy.However, the construction of a dam wall is not without its challenges. Environmental concerns often arise, as the creation of a reservoir can lead to habitat loss for wildlife and displacement of local communities. It is essential for engineers and policymakers to carefully assess the potential impacts of a dam wall before proceeding with construction. Sustainable practices, such as fish ladders and sediment management, can help mitigate some of these negative effects, allowing for a balance between human needs and environmental preservation.Moreover, the structural integrity of a dam wall must be meticulously maintained. Over time, factors such as erosion, seepage, and structural fatigue can compromise the safety of the dam wall. Regular inspections and maintenance are critical to ensuring that these structures remain safe and functional. In recent years, advancements in technology have allowed for more effective monitoring systems, enabling engineers to detect potential issues early and address them promptly.In conclusion, the role of a dam wall in our society is multifaceted, providing essential benefits for water management, energy production, and community safety. While there are challenges associated with their construction and maintenance, the advantages of a well-designed dam wall far outweigh the drawbacks. As we continue to face global challenges related to water scarcity and climate change, the importance of these structures will only grow, making it imperative that we invest in their development and upkeep responsibly. Through careful planning and innovative engineering, we can ensure that dam walls serve their purpose effectively while minimizing their impact on the environment and local communities.
